Property Details for 150 Main St, Beeac

150 Main St, Beeac is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om House and was built in 2007. The property has a land size of 4013m2 and floor size of 147m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in September 2022.

About Beeac 3251

The size of Beeac is approximately 112.9 square kilometres. There are 2 parks, covering nearly 4.7% of the total area. The population of Beeac in 2016 was 370 people. By 2021 the population was 394 showing a population growth of 6.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Beeac is 50-59 years. Households in Beeac are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Beeac work in a managers occupation.In 2021, 81.80% of the homes in Beeac were owner-occupied compared with 81.10% in 2016.

Beeac has 365 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Beeac have seen a 26.18% increase in median value. As at 31 May 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Beeac is $513,492 while the median value for Units is $197,433.
There are currently 1 property listed for sale, and no properties listed for rent in Beeac on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 18 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Beeac.
